Brian starts his role at GitLab and continues to make progress on outsourcing development with JTBD.app. Benedikt recaps the email marketing feature launch and shares open roles at Userlist. Benedicte prepares for the Gatsby mini bootcamp kickoff, discusses pricing strategy, and wonders, "Don’t we all want a successful SaaS?"
Brian's first day at GitLab was as expected — he started setting up and filled out HR paperwork. Learning about the remote-first culture was fascinating, though. On JTBD.app, onboarding development help is getting more exciting. He expects progress on feature improvements soon.
Benedikt recaps the email marketing feature launch from last week at Userlist. He feels good about it but anticipates some time before seeing an impact beyond the initial marketing splash. Userlist is looking to hire a customer success manager and a front end web developer and Benedikt is finalizing the job post for the latter.
Benedicte is preparing for the Gatsby mini bootcamp that launches this weekend! Between planning other topics, iterating on pricing, and building a community, there's a lot of work to be done. Ideally, the up-front effort could make for a rewarding long-term project. POW! is something that Benedicte wants to maintain on the side because... "Don’t we all want a successful SaaS?"
